How can people who are not religious walk their spiritual pilgrimage? Can you be their companion? Walking with the Spiritual but Not Religious takes a fresh look at being a spiritual companion for those who self-identify as something other than religious—SBNR, Nones, not religious, agnostics, atheists, people who have experienced something unexplainable, and those who have encountered the paranormal (religious or otherwise). For over two decades, Catherine and Gil Stafford have been spiritual companions and practitioners of an ancient/new way of imagining the art of soul-making. Skilled in the art of deep listening, they have infused this book with the wisdom they have learned by listening to spiritual-but-not-religious people talk about their path—and by walking that path themselves. Catherine and Gil Stafford have filled a void in the literary world by writing and publishing Walking with the Spiritual but Not Religious, a book written by, for, and from the experience of being in relationship with people who are SBNR. Rooted in Jungian wisdom and filled with personal stories, the book offers insights and tools for exploring one's dreams, identifying and working with allies in the spiritual realm, utilizing the enneagram and MBTI, creating rituals, as well as walking labyrinths. The section on meditation, contemplation, and mindfulnesses thoroughly distinguishes among these three areas and equips the reader with a variety of practices in each. The chapter Your Personal Narrative: Writing is Magic invites the reader to actively discover their evolving story, their very being, through imagination, writing, and engaging the practices discussed in the book. "Our personal narrative is the story of how we are the living embodiment of the experimental life...It's when the experiment beings writing itself and that writing begins to write us-writing becomes the art of magical soul-making."
